Calculated Multiples and Bankroll Management
Apart from superstition, a large part of the UK Avia Fly 2 community exhibits strategic number behaviour aimed at managing their money. We notice a strong inclination towards bets that are clean fractions or multiples of a player’s total session budget. A player with £20 to spend might adhere strictly to £1 bets (which is one-twentieth of the bankroll) or bets of £0.80. This systematic method offers precise control over the number of spins and overall risk. Numbers that make for easy division, like 10, 20, 25, and 100, naturally become popular. This pattern points to a mature, calculated approach. The goal here is to prolong entertainment and maintain a strategic presence, not to chase big jackpots with impulsive, large bets.
The Thinking of Round Numbers
Round numbers like 10, 20, 50, and 100 hold a strong appeal in Avia Fly 2. These figures are cognitively simple. They are easy to process, remember, and keep track of. When a player sets a win target of £50 or a loss limit of £20, these round numbers create firm mental lines. That clarity cuts down on decision fatigue and emotional strain during a session. Also, hitting a win that lands exactly on a round number, like cashing out at a neat £100, delivers a stronger sense of satisfaction and closure than winning £97.43 would. This mental principle, often termed “round-number bias,” is a major reason players build a structured and personally satisfying session, whether they recognize they’re doing it or not.
